
Ever since Virat Kohli scored 122 runs in the opening match against Afghanistan in the Asia Cup, the discussion has started as to who will be Rohit Sharma's partner in the upcoming T20 World Cup - KL Rahul or Virat Kohli. While Rahul's bat has not been able to do anything special this year, Virat has returned to form from the Asia Cup.
How have both been performing in 2022?
This year KL Rahul has played 5 T20 matches for India. He has scored 132 runs in these 5 matches at an average of 26.40. At the same time, the strike rate of this player has been only 122.22. If we talk about Virat Kohli, then this year he is better than KL Rahul in every sense. He has scored 357 runs in 9 matches at an impressive average of 51.00. During this, his strike rate has been 142.80.
Virat becomes dangerous while opening
When the former captain of Team India bats in the T20 International, his bat speaks fiercely. He has opened for India in 9 matches so far. During this, Virat has scored 400 runs at an impressive average of 57.14. His strike rate during this period has been 161.29.
When King Kohli comes to bat at number-3 or number-4, he plays some ball dot, but when this player comes on the field as an opener, he starts hitting big shots from the very first ball. This has been seen not only in T20 Internationals but also in IPL. Virat has scored 5 centuries while batting in the IPL. At the same time, his only century in T20 International has also come while opening.
No runs from KL Rahul's bat when needed
KL Rahul continues to flop while batting the opening. Take it in the Asia Cup itself, he returned to the pavilion without opening the account against Pakistan. At the same time, in the second match against a weak team like Hong Kong, he scored 36 runs, but on 39 balls. When the Indian team came out to play a do-or-die match against Sri Lanka, only 6 runs came out of Rahul's bat. Although he scored 62 runs against Afghanistan, by then the journey of Team India from the Asia Cup was over.
His similar performance was also in the 2021 T20 World Cup. Against Pakistan, his bat scored 3 runs and against New Zealand, 18 runs came off 16 balls. He then scored 54 off 36 balls against Namibia and 50 off 19 balls against Scotland. Both these innings did not make any sense, because by then Team India was out of the World Cup.
In such a situation, KL Rahul's claim as an opener in the T20 World Cup is continuously weakening. At the same time, Virat is seen challenging him.
